StyleWriter 1.0 contains a buffer overflow vulnerability that allows local attackers to crash the application by supplying an excessively long string. Attackers can paste a 6000-byte payload into the Pattern to Find or Advice Message fields in the Add Pattern dialog to trigger a denial of service condition. This vulnerability has a CVSS score of 6.9, which classifies it as medium severity, indicating a significant risk to affected systems.
The potential impact of this vulnerability is substantial, as it may allow attackers to cause disruption to users by crashing the application. Organizations using StyleWriter 1.0 should take immediate action to remediate this vulnerability, as failure to do so could lead to a denial of service.
Given the nature of this vulnerability, organizations should prioritize patching immediately. Ensuring that all instances of StyleWriter 1.0 are updated can mitigate the risk associated with this vulnerability.
As of now, there is no known public exploit available, nor is the vulnerability actively being exploited in the wild. However, organizations should remain vigilant and monitor for any updates regarding this vulnerability.
Vulnerability Details
The vulnerability is classified under CWE-120, which indicates a buffer copy without checking the size of the input. This type of vulnerability can lead to a crash or potentially allow unauthorized actions if not addressed.
The CVSS 4.0 vector string for this vulnerability is CVSS:4.0/AV:L/AC:L/PR:N/UI:N/VC:N/VI:N/VA:H, reflecting a local attack vector and low complexity. The availability impact is rated as high, meaning that an attack may significantly disrupt service availability.
Technical Analysis
The root cause of this vulnerability lies in the inadequate validation of input length in the Add Pattern dialog. By entering an excessively long string, local attackers can exploit this oversight to cause a buffer overflow, leading to application crashes.
The attack vector is local, meaning that an attacker must have access to the system where StyleWriter 1.0 is installed. The complexity of the attack is low, as it can be executed with ease by any user with sufficient access to the application.
No special privileges are required to exploit this vulnerability, and user interaction is not necessary, which further simplifies the exploitation process. The availability impact is significant, as a successful attack can render the application unusable.
Risk & Impact Analysis
Risk to organizations includes application downtime and potential loss of productivity for users relying on StyleWriter 1.0. The blast radius of this vulnerability can extend to any user of the application, making timely remediation crucial.
The urgency of addressing this vulnerability is medium, and organizations should schedule remediation efforts as part of their priority patch cycle to minimize the risk of disruption.
Signal | Status |
|---|---|
Known Exploit | No |
Public PoC | No |
Actively Exploited | No |
Ransomware Use | No |
Affected Versions
As there are no specific version numbers listed in the current data, it is advised that organizations consider all versions of StyleWriter prior to any patches as affected.
Mitigation & Remediation
Organizations should prioritize patching StyleWriter 1.0 to remediate this vulnerability. If a patch is not available, consider disabling the application until a fix can be applied. Additionally, implementing input validation controls can help prevent excessive input lengths.
For more comprehensive security assessments, organizations may want to engage in penetration testing to identify further vulnerabilities.
Detection Guidance
Security teams should monitor application logs for unusual crash patterns or error messages that may indicate attempts to exploit this vulnerability. Additionally, behavioral anomalies in the application's usage may signal potential attempts at exploitation.
AppSecure Threat Intelligence Insight
The long-term significance of this vulnerability highlights the need for enhanced input validation mechanisms in applications. Security teams should continuously assess their applications for similar vulnerabilities, as the risks associated with buffer overflows can lead to significant operational disruptions.
To further fortify defenses, organizations may benefit from referencing best practices in penetration testing methodology and implementing a robust vulnerability management program to proactively identify and address security weaknesses.
Lastly, engaging in AI security best practices can offer additional layers of protection against evolving threats.
Disclaimer: This content was generated using AI. While we strive for accuracy, please verify critical information with official sources.

.webp)